Skip to content

Commit

Permalink
💄 Style modal
Browse files Browse the repository at this point in the history
  • Loading branch information
superbuggy committed Sep 13, 2024
1 parent 12117d3 commit 7284066
Showing 1 changed file with 33 additions and 17 deletions.
50 changes: 33 additions & 17 deletions src/components/FlawAffects/FlawAffects.vue
Original file line number Diff line number Diff line change
Expand Up @@ -606,34 +606,50 @@ const displayedTrackers = computed(() => {
@affects:refresh="emit('affects:refresh')"
/>
</div>
<Modal :show="isManageTrackersModalOpen" style="max-width: 75%;" @close="closeManagersTrackersModal">
<template #header>
<div class="d-flex w-100">
<h4 class="m-0">Tracker Manager</h4>
<div class="osim-tracker-manager-modal-container">
<Modal :show="isManageTrackersModalOpen" style="max-width: 75%;" @close="closeManagersTrackersModal">
<template #body>
<button
type="button"
class="btn btn-close ms-auto"
aria-label="Close"
@click="closeManagersTrackersModal"
/>
</div>
</template>
<template #body>
<TrackerManager
:relatedFlaws="relatedFlaws"
:flaw="flaw"
@affects-trackers:refresh="refreshAffects"
/>
</template>
<template #footer>
<div></div>
</template>
</Modal>
<TrackerManager
:relatedFlaws="relatedFlaws"
:flaw="flaw"
@affects-trackers:refresh="refreshAffects"
/>
</template>
</Modal>
</div>
</template>

<style scoped lang="scss">
@import '@/scss/bootstrap-overrides';
.osim-tracker-manager-modal-container {
&:deep(.modal-header),
&:deep(.modal-footer) {
display: none;
}
&:deep(.modal-body) {
position: relative;
padding: 0;
.osim-affect-trackers-container {
margin: 0 !important;
}
}
:deep(.btn-close) {
position: absolute;
top: 1rem;
right: 1rem;
}
}
.osim-affects-section {
margin-block: 1rem;
Expand Down

0 comments on commit 7284066

Please sign in to comment.